The article noted that on October 7, a discussion group under the auspices of the AFSC was addressed by HLRRY WILLIAMS "of the Education Department of the Commmist Party here." Acgarding to the article, about 50 young pecpls were present. The article also noted that a Speakers Bureau had been set up by the Communist Party of Eastern Pennsylvania and Delaware, and that speakers would be furnished for meetings within the Philadelphia area. — . _ he “Workert is the Sunday edition of the "pally warker,* an‘East———— ~. .
